Rule 42 - Nonprobationary Enforcement Officer; Discharge, Demotion, or Suspension
Section 42-1 - Definitions

Universal Citation: 905 IN Admin Code 42-1

Current through March 20, 2024

Authority: IC 7.1-2-2-12; IC 7.1-2-3-7

Affected: IC 7.1-2-2-12

Sec. 1.

(a) "Department" refers to the Indiana alcoholic beverage commission, also known as the Indiana state excise police department.

(b) "Nonprobationary officer" means an enforcement officer of the department who has successfully completed the probationary period.

(c) "Probationary officer" means a newly employed enforcement officer of the department who has not successfully completed the probationary period.

(d) "Superintendent" refers to the person designated by the commission as the commander, administrator, and supervisor of the Indiana alcoholic beverage commission enforcement officers.

(e) "Commanding officer" refers to an enforcement officer in a supervisory position.
